Material Insight: Fabric For Car Roof

fabric for car roof

Automotive interiors demand materials that combine durability, aesthetic appeal, and long-term performance—especially in demanding applications like car roof linings. Fabric for car roof must withstand constant exposure to temperature fluctuations, UV radiation, and mechanical stress while maintaining a premium appearance and acoustic comfort. Among the available materials, automotive leather—particularly high-performance synthetic leather—has emerged as the optimal solution for modern vehicle design.

Automotive leather offers superior advantages over traditional textiles and natural leather in roof applications. It provides excellent resistance to fading, cracking, and abrasion, ensuring longevity even under intense sunlight and extreme climates. Its uniform texture and color consistency allow for seamless integration across interior designs, while advanced backing systems enhance sound absorption and thermal insulation. Additionally, synthetic automotive leather is engineered to be lightweight, contributing to overall vehicle efficiency—a key consideration in today’s automotive manufacturing.

Key Technical Advantages

  • Superior Abrasion Resistance: Engineered with a proprietary high-density polyurethane matrix and reinforced backing, WINIW roof fabric exceeds ISO 12947-2 (Martindale) standards, enduring 50,000+ cycles without visible wear. This exceptional durability ensures long-term aesthetic integrity against head contact, luggage handling, and routine maintenance, significantly reducing warranty claims and enhancing perceived vehicle quality.
  • Exceptional UV & Weathering Resistance: Utilizing advanced UV-stabilized polymers and inorganic pigments, the fabric maintains colorfastness (ΔE < 1.5 after 1000h QUV-A) and physical properties under intense solar radiation per SAE J2527. Prevents cracking, fading, and embrittlement, critical for vehicles operating in high-sunlight regions and ensuring consistent appearance throughout the vehicle lifecycle.
  • Guaranteed VOC-Free Cabin Environment: Rigorously tested per ISO 12219-2 (28-day chamber method), WINIW roof fabric emits VOCs below 10 µg/m³ for critical compounds (formaldehyde, benzene, toluene). Achieves “VOC Free” status by eliminating solvents, plasticizers, and harmful emissions during production, directly contributing to healthier cabin air quality and compliance with global automotive air quality regulations (e.g., VDA 270, GB/T 27630).
  • Full REACH SVHC Compliance: Proactively screened and certified free of all Substances of Very High Concern (SVHCs) listed under EU REACH Regulation (EC 1907/2006). Includes zero content of phthalates, heavy metals (Cd, Pb, Hg, Cr⁶⁺), and other restricted substances, ensuring seamless market access across Europe and alignment with global chemical safety directives.
  • ISO 9001:2015 Certified Quality Management: Manufactured within a globally recognized ISO 9001:2015 certified production system. Ensures consistent dimensional stability, color matching (ΔE < 0.5 batch-to-batch), and physical properties through stringent in-process controls, statistical process monitoring, and traceability from raw material to finished roll.

WINIW Automotive Roof Fabric: Technical Specifications

Property Test Method Performance Value Significance for Automotive Roof Application
Abrasion Resistance ISO 12947-2 (Martindale) ≥ 50,000 cycles (no wear) Withstands repeated passenger contact & cleaning; prevents premature wear
Colorfastness (UV) SAE J2527 ΔE < 1.5 after 1000h Maintains color integrity under intense sunlight; no fading
Total VOC Emission ISO 12219-2 < 10 µg/m³ (28-day) Ensures premium cabin air quality; meets strict OEM specs
Tensile Strength ASTM D412 ≥ 35 MPa (MD), ≥ 32 MPa (CD) Resists tearing during installation & vehicle use
REACH SVHC Status Internal Screening + 3rd Party Lab Not Detected (0%) Guarantees regulatory compliance & supply chain safety
Dimensional Stability ISO 2231 ±0.5% (85°C, 24h) Prevents shrinkage/warping during roof liner thermoforming
Flammability FMVSS 302 Pass (≤ 100 mm/min) Meets mandatory US/Global automotive safety standards

Why Choose Synthetic over Real Leather

fabric for car roof

B2B Product Guide: Synthetic Fabric for Car Roof vs. Real Leather

In the automotive interior market, material selection for car roofs significantly impacts both performance and sustainability. While real leather has traditionally been used for premium interiors, advanced synthetic fabrics—particularly high-performance microfiber leather like WINIW’s offerings—have emerged as competitive alternatives. These materials provide comparable aesthetics with enhanced functional and environmental benefits, especially in overhead applications such as car roof liners.

When evaluating materials for car roof applications, key considerations include cost efficiency, durability under stress and environmental exposure, and environmental impact. Real leather, though valued for its natural texture and prestige, presents several limitations in this specific use case. In contrast, synthetic fabrics engineered for automotive use offer tailored performance characteristics ideal for modern vehicle design.

  • Synthetic fabrics for car roofs are lightweight, contributing to improved fuel efficiency and reduced emissions.
  • They offer excellent resistance to UV degradation, preventing fading and cracking common in real leather.
  • Customization in texture, color, and finish allows for brand-specific design flexibility.
  • Unlike real leather, synthetic options do not require animal sourcing, aligning with cruelty-free and sustainable manufacturing standards.
  • These materials are highly consistent in quality, avoiding the natural imperfections found in animal hides.

Below is a comparative analysis of synthetic fabric for car roofs and real leather across critical business and sustainability metrics:

Criteria Synthetic Fabric for Car Roof Real Leather
Cost Lower material and processing costs; scalable production Higher due to raw material scarcity, tanning, and yield loss
Trwałość High resistance to tearing, UV, moisture, and temperature fluctuations; ideal for overhead use Prone to cracking, fading, and sagging over time, especially under UV exposure
Eco-friendliness Made from recycled or low-impact polymers; lower carbon footprint; many options are recyclable High environmental cost: resource-intensive farming, chemical tanning, and significant water/energy use

Key Benefits for Car Roof Applications

  • Superior dimensional stability prevents sagging and warping over time
  • Lightweight construction contributes to overall vehicle efficiency
  • Excellent drapability and sewability for complex headliner contours
  • High resistance to temperature fluctuations (-40°C to +120°C)
  • Low fogging and compliant with ISO 6452 and VDA 278 for interior air quality
  • UV-resistant pigments maintain color integrity with prolonged sun exposure
  • Available with anti-static and acoustic backing options for enhanced comfort

Technical Specifications (Typical Values)

Property Test Method Performance
Thickness ISO 2589 0.8 – 1.2 mm
Tensile Strength (MD) ISO 10361 ≥ 25 MPa
Elongation at Break (MD) ISO 10361 ≥ 80%
Tear Strength ISO 10362 ≥ 80 N
Flame Resistance FMVSS 302, ISO 3795 Pass
Fogging (Gravimetric) ISO 6452 ≤ 2.0 mg
Color Fastness to Light (Xenon) ISO 105-B02 ≥ 6 (after 500 hrs)
